uk/ˈpɑː.səl/us/ˈpɑːr.səl/parcel noun [ C ] (TO SEND)
B1 mainly UK US usually package an object or collection of objects wrapped in paper, especially so that it can be sent by post:
a food parcel
The parcel was wrapped in plain brown paper.

parcel noun [ C ] (LAND)
mainly US UK usually plot an area of land:
a 60-acre parcel
